Ludhiana, Dec. 24 -- Students at the Government Institute for the Blind at Braille Bhawan will receive an innovative electronic device - Annie - next week that would make Braille learning easy, said deputy commissioner Jitendra Jorwal on Tuesday. The device is designed to revolutionise early Braille learning through interactive audio lessons and gamified activities, officials said.

The district administration has initially procured one 'Annie' device, with plans to expand its availability in the coming months. The device is expected to make Braille learning more engaging and accessible for visually impaired students, paving the way for a more inclusive educational environment.
